I was deleting some old files on the computer, and apparently deleted something useful... So stupid. Anyhow, I reinstalled InDesigner several times, also using AdobeCleaner. It keeps showing me this message every time I run the program:
"Some files required for colour management are missing. Please re-install the application to ensure proper functioning." - Any suggestions? Can I somehow re-install color managment files?
1 Correct answer
On OSX the default recommended profiles get installed here:
/Library/Application Support/Adobe/Color/Profiles/Recommended
If you deleted any of these folders you would get the message—I think these are the profiles installed by Adobe in Application Support:
